It can be hard to translate regular season success to the playoffs, but High Tech Mesa had no problem doing just that on Wednesday. They walked away with a 3-1 victory over the El Camino Wildcats. Winning may never get old, but the Thunder sure are getting used to it with their third in a row.
High Tech Mesa walked away with the win (and looked especially good in the first set). The final score came out to 25-12, 25-18, 24-26, 25-20.
Leading High Tech Mesa to victory were Blu Ellison and Jana Impreso. Ellison had seven aces, while Impreso had ten digs. Ellison is crushing it when it comes to aces: she's served at least two every time she's taken the court this season.
High Tech Mesa was lethal from the service line and finished the game with 16 aces.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now served at least seven aces in seven consecutive contests.
Despite the loss, El Camino still got an impressive performance from Makayla Boone, who had 21 digs.
High Tech Mesa is on a roll lately: they've won nine of their last 11 games, which provided a nice bump to their 19-11 record this season. As for El Camino, their loss ended a five-game streak of away wins and brought them to 25-18.
High Tech Mesa will take on Lincoln at 5:00 p.m. on Saturday. Lincoln will roll in looking for their 17th straight victory, something High Tech Mesa surely won't give up without a fight. El Camino does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
